1. Amalfi Coast, Italy

The Amalfi Coast looks exactly like every photograph you have ever seen of it, which sounds like a criticism but is actually the highest possible compliment. Some places disappoint in person. This one does not. Cliffside villages painted in lemon yellow and terracotta pink drop straight into water so blue it looks digitally enhanced.

Positano is the most famous stop and worth at least two nights. Ravello sits higher in the hills and offers a quieter, more intimate experience that suits anniversary couples better than the busier coastal towns. The food along the Amalfi Coast is exceptional even by Italian standards. Fresh seafood, handmade pasta, local limoncello, and meals that last two hours because neither of you wants them to end. Renting a small boat for a half day to explore sea caves and hidden coves privately is one of those experiences that gets referenced for years in the “remember when” category.

2. Kyoto, Japan

Kyoto rewards couples who want beauty, calm, and a sense of being somewhere genuinely unlike anywhere else. It is not a loud or flashy destination. It is deliberate and layered, and the more time you give it, the more it gives back.

The bamboo groves of Arashiyama in the early morning, before tour groups arrive, feel almost cinematic in their stillness. Staying in a traditional ryokan inn, where dinner is served in your room across low tables in yukata robes, is one of the most romantic accommodation experiences available anywhere in the world at any price point. A private tea ceremony, a walk through the Fushimi Inari shrine at dusk, and a kaiseki dinner that takes two hours to complete are the kinds of shared experiences that quietly become the defining memories of a marriage. Japan overall rewards couples who appreciate culture, food, and beauty over nightlife and beaches.

3. Santorini, Greece

Santorini earns its reputation for romance completely. The caldera views from Oia at sunset are genuinely breathtaking in a way that even the most seen-it-all traveler struggles to stay casual about. Standing there together after ten years carries a particular weight that is hard to describe until you’re in it.

Cave hotels carved into the volcanic cliffside range from accessible luxury to full private plunge pool suites where the infinity edge drops straight toward the Aegean. Breakfast delivered to your terrace with that view is the kind of detail that does not feel real until it is happening. Wine from local Assyrtiko grapes pairs with fresh grilled octopus and views of neighboring islands in a way that feels almost staged for romance. Direct flights from Athens take forty-five minutes, and Athens itself is worth two or three days before or after Santorini to add depth to the trip.

New Zealand’s South Island

The South Island of New Zealand is one of the most dramatically beautiful places on earth, and for couples who connect through shared adventure, it is close to perfect. Fiordland National Park and Milford Sound are the obvious highlights, where waterfalls drop from peaks directly into glassy fjords below and the scale of everything makes you feel appropriately small and grateful to be alive and together.

Queenstown offers bungee jumping, skydiving, jet boating, and helicopter glacier landings, all within a short drive of each other. A campervan road trip across the South Island, stopping wherever looks interesting, is one of the most genuinely free and romantic formats a couple can choose. The scenery shifts dramatically every few hours from coast to mountains to wine valleys, and Marlborough’s vineyards at the north of the island are a beautiful way to wind down after days of adrenaline.

Patagonia, Chile and Argentina

Patagonia is raw in a way that most destinations simply are not. Torres del Paine National Park in Chile and Los Glaciares National Park in Argentina offer landscapes that look like they belong in a fantasy novel. Hiking the W Trek together, camping under skies that have more stars than most people see in a lifetime, creates a shared physical and emotional experience that a luxury beach resort simply cannot replicate.

This is not a trip for couples who want pampering as the primary experience. It is a trip for couples who want to feel genuinely tested and triumphant together. The combination of challenge and beauty is its own form of romance, and anniversary couples who return from Patagonia tend to talk about it as one of the most connected experiences of their relationship.

4. Maldives

The Maldives is the apex of the overwater bungalow experience, and for a tenth anniversary, it delivers exactly what it promises without needing any justification. Some trips are worth the splurge, and this is one of them.

An overwater villa at a resort like Soneva Fushi, Gili Lankanfushi, or the more accessible Cinnamon Dhonveli puts you directly above turquoise water with a private deck, a glass floor panel showing fish swimming beneath you, and a ladder down into the lagoon from your bedroom. Snorkeling directly from your villa, private sunset dinners on sandbanks arranged by the resort, and the extraordinary quality of doing absolutely nothing together in a genuinely beautiful place are what make the Maldives worth its premium price. Direct flights from Dubai, Doha, or Singapore keep travel time reasonable from most departure points.

5. Porto and the Douro Valley, Portugal

Porto is the romantic Portuguese city that nobody warns you about, and the Douro Valley stretching east from it is one of the most quietly spectacular wine regions on the planet. For anniversary couples who love food, wine, and beauty without the crowds of more famous destinations, this combination is close to perfect.

Spend two to three nights in Porto eating fresh seafood at the Ribeira waterfront, drinking port at cave tasting rooms across the river in Vila Nova de Gaia, and getting pleasantly lost in the tiled streets of the historic center. Then rent a car or book a river cruise and head into the Douro Valley, where terraced vineyards climb steeply from the riverbanks and quintas, traditional wine estates, offer tastings and overnight stays in converted manor houses. Dinner at a quinta overlooking the valley with a bottle of aged tawny port and a sunset that takes thirty minutes to fully complete is a very strong argument for Portugal as one of the best anniversary destinations in Europe.

6. Tuscany, Italy

Tuscany works for tenth anniversaries the way a perfectly broken-in leather jacket works: it is comfortable, beautiful, and just classic enough to never feel like a mistake. The rolling hills, cypress-lined roads, stone farmhouses, and wine culture create a backdrop for romance that requires almost no effort to enjoy.

Renting a private villa in the countryside between Florence and Siena, even for three or four nights, sets a tone that no hotel can fully replicate. A private pool, a kitchen stocked from a local market, dinners cooked together with fresh pasta and a bottle of Brunello, and mornings with nowhere specific to be are exactly what ten years together has earned. Day trips into Siena, San Gimignano, and Montalcino fill any desire for sightseeing without making the trip feel like a checklist. Florence itself deserves two full days before or after the countryside portion.

7. Bora Bora, French Polynesia

Bora Bora sits in a lagoon so impossibly colored that first-time visitors spend the initial hours just staring at it in a state of mild disbelief. The water shifts between a dozen shades of blue and green depending on depth and time of day, and the volcanic peak of Mount Otemanu rises dramatically from the center of the island.

Overwater bungalows here are the original, and while the Maldives has replicated the concept at scale, Bora Bora’s version feels more intimate and dramatically set. The Four Seasons and the St. Regis are the benchmark properties, but the Intercontinental and Le Bora Bora by Pearl Resorts offer genuine luxury at meaningfully lower prices. Shark and ray snorkeling directly in the lagoon, private sunset sailing, and beachside couples massages are the activity menu here. Flights from Los Angeles on Air Tahiti Nui take about eight hours, and the resort transfers by speedboat across the lagoon are their own small moment worth anticipating.

8. Vienna and Prague Back-to-Back

Two cities, one trip, and an anniversary itinerary that covers both romance and genuine cultural richness. Vienna and Prague are connected by a four-hour direct train on RegioJet or FlixBus, which makes combining them into one ten-day trip completely effortless.

Vienna operates at a grand, imperial scale. Coffee houses where you sit for two hours over a melange and a slice of Sachertorte, opera performances at the Staatsoper, and candlelit dinners in converted palace restaurants set a tone of old-world romance that suits a significant anniversary beautifully. Prague offers a completely different energy: a preserved medieval city center, atmospheric wine bars in stone cellars, and a slower, more wandering pace. Staying in a boutique hotel in Prague’s Malá Strana neighborhood, within walking distance of Charles Bridge, with river views from the room, is one of the most romantic city hotel experiences in all of Europe at a price point significantly below what a comparable room in Paris or Rome would cost.

How to Choose the Right Anniversary Destination for Your Relationship

Ten years of marriage means you know your partner better than any travel guide does. The right destination is the one that reflects who you actually are as a couple, not the one that looks most impressive in a caption.

Ask each other a few honest questions before booking. Do you recharge through activity or stillness? Do you connect over shared adventure or shared indulgence? Is this trip primarily about celebrating or primarily about experiencing something new together? Couples who answer these questions honestly before booking almost always end up happier with their choice than those who pick based on what seems most appropriately romantic from the outside. A stunning ryokan in Kyoto is meaningless if one of you needs a beach and movement. A Maldives overwater villa is wasted if both of you would rather be hiking something extraordinary.

Also consider the practical reality of your lives right now. If you have young children, proximity and a shorter trip that you can actually fully enjoy might outperform a two-week epic that leaves everyone exhausted and stressed about logistics. If this is your first big trip alone in years, lean toward a destination with infrastructure that makes things easy rather than one that requires constant problem-solving. The romance lives in the connection, not in the difficulty level of getting there.

What are the best travel destinations for couples on their tenth anniversary with a moderate budget?

Porto and the Douro Valley, Kyoto, and Prague all deliver exceptional anniversary experiences without requiring the budget of Bora Bora or the Maldives. Kyoto ryokan stays can be found for $150 to $250 a night at genuinely beautiful properties. Porto offers excellent boutique hotels for $120 to $180. Prague provides some of the best value luxury accommodation in Europe, with top-tier boutique hotels running $100 to $200 a night in the historic center.

How far in advance should we book a tenth anniversary trip?

For peak season travel to high-demand destinations like Santorini, the Maldives, or Bora Bora, six to nine months in advance is realistic for the properties and dates you actually want. For Europe outside of summer, three to four months is usually sufficient. Booking flights and accommodation together at the same time prevents the situation where you have great flights but no rooms at the property you wanted.

Should we use a travel agent for a major anniversary trip?

For complex itineraries involving overwater villas, ryokans, or back-to-back destinations, a specialist travel agent genuinely earns their fee. They access rates and room categories not available on public booking sites, handle logistics that would take hours to coordinate independently, and have direct contacts at properties who can arrange anniversary surprises. Fora Travel and Virtuoso-affiliated agents are worth the conversation for a trip of this significance.

Is travel insurance worth it for an anniversary trip?

Absolutely, and more so than for any casual trip. The financial investment in a tenth anniversary trip is typically significant, and the emotional stakes are high. Cancel For Any Reason policies through companies like Allianz or Travel Guard protect the investment if life intervenes unexpectedly. Medical coverage matters especially for international travel. The peace of mind alone is worth the 5 to 8 percent of total trip cost that a comprehensive policy typically runs.

What is a meaningful way to mark the anniversary during the trip itself?

Arrange something specific and personal rather than a generic hotel amenity. A private dinner on a beach, a cooking class together learning the local cuisine, a boat trip to a private cove, or a sunrise hike to a viewpoint you researched specifically. The most memorable anniversary moments tend to be the ones that required a little intention to create rather than the ones that came automatically with the hotel package.
